Why a Replacement Pump for Soap Dispenser Is Necessary
From my experience, having a replacement pump for a soap dispenser is essential because these pumps tend to wear out or get clogged over time. I’ve noticed that no matter how careful I am, soap residue builds up inside the pump mechanism, causing it to stop working smoothly or completely. Instead of replacing the entire dispenser, swapping out the pump saves me time and money.
Additionally, I find that having a spare pump on hand ensures I’m never caught without soap when the original pump breaks unexpectedly. It’s a small part, but it plays a big role in keeping my kitchen or bathroom running smoothly. Plus, sometimes the pump’s spring loses tension, making it hard to dispense soap properly, and a quick replacement fixes the problem instantly.
In short, a replacement pump is a simple, affordable way to extend the life of my soap dispenser and avoid unnecessary hassle. It’s definitely a practical solution I rely on to keep things working efficiently.
My Buying Guides on Replacement Pump For Soap Dispenser
When my soap dispenser pump broke, I realized how important it is to find the right replacement pump. After some trial and error, I’ve learned a few key things that can help you pick the perfect pump for your soap dispenser. Here’s my guide based on my experience.
1. Identify Your Soap Dispenser Type
The first thing I did was check what kind of soap dispenser I have. Pumps can vary depending on whether your dispenser is for liquid soap, foaming soap, or lotion. Make sure you know which type you need because a foaming pump works differently from a regular liquid soap pump.
2. Measure the Pump and Neck Size
I found it very helpful to measure the diameter of the dispenser neck and the length of the pump tube. Most pumps come in standard sizes like 24/410 or 28/410, which refer to the neck diameter and thread size. Getting the right size ensures a snug fit without leaks.
3. Check the Pump Material and Durability
Since soap dispensers get used frequently, I look for pumps made of sturdy materials like high-quality plastic or stainless steel springs inside the pump. This makes a big difference in how long the replacement pump lasts before needing another swap.
4. Consider the Dispensing Volume per Pump
Different pumps release different amounts of soap per press. I prefer pumps that deliver enough soap in one pump but don’t waste excess. If you want a gentler dose, look for pumps labeled with smaller milliliter outputs, usually around 1 ml or less.
5. Compatibility with Soap Type
Some pumps work better with thicker soaps or lotions, while others are designed for thinner liquid soaps. I double-check the product description to ensure the pump suits the soap consistency I use daily. Otherwise, the pump might clog or not dispense smoothly.
6. Ease of Installation
Since I’m not very handy, I appreciate pumps that are easy to install and don’t require tools. Most replacement pumps simply screw on, but it’s good to verify this before buying, especially if your dispenser has a unique design.
7. Price and Quantity Options
I usually look for value packs or multi-packs of replacement pumps because having a spare handy saves time later. Prices vary, so I balance cost with quality, avoiding extremely cheap pumps that tend to break quickly.
8. Read Reviews and Brand Reputation
Before finalizing my purchase, I always read customer reviews to see if other buyers had good experiences with the pump’s fit and durability. Trusted brands often provide better quality control, which reduces the chances of compatibility issues.
